Valley Nature Center
Is composed of a half-mile nature trail winding its way through five acres of native Valley vegetation and also includes butterfly gardens, ponds and cactus gardens. The indoor Exhibit Hall features interactive children’s exhibits of native wildlife and habitat, as well as a Gift Shop. 301 S. Border in Gibson Park.
